The interpretation of peers is friends, friends or people who work and do together. Peer friends are interactions in a group of people with the same age, growth or social status, and have a relatively large level of intimacy among the group. In peers, people generally find social support that refers to fun.
Another interpretation of peers is a group of people who are almost the same age and have various things in common such as hobbies, interests, and other interesting things. The background of the occurrence of peer groups is the growth of the socialization process, the need to receive appreciation, the need for attention from others, the desire to create the world.
People who are almost the same age as their friends generally have almost the same level of maturity or growth. Not only that, the selected peers are generally friends who have the same social status with other people. Peers are also people who often participate in carrying out actions together in association.
